New embedded and portable windowing system, client/server interface between display hardware (mouse, keyboard, video displays) and the desktop environment that works on many hardware, including embedded devices (handhelds, set-top boxes, etc.) has been released by Xynth.
They say "The name Xynth comes from the coordinate system, which is the heart of the Xynth Windowing System design. Xynth is a LGPL licensed free software project. It aims to provide a lightweight GUI supported windowing system for Linux-based and/or real-time embedded systems." The project's range is embedded systems to desktops.
